LMIA-Exempt Work Permit
LMIA-exempt work permits in Canada fall under the International Mobility Program (IMP), allowing employers to hire foreign workers without a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A). These permits apply to specific occupations and situations, including international agreements, intra-company transfers, and economic benefit categories. The IMP streamlines temporary worker entry while supporting Canada’s labor market needs.

Categories in
LMIA-Exempt Work Permit

International Trade Agreements
Work permits issued under trade agreements such as CUSMA, CETA, and CPTPP facilitating temporary employment of eligible professionals and intra-company transferees.

Intra-Company Transfers
Transfers of executives, managers, and specialized knowledge workers within multinational corporations, meeting specific regulatory criteria

International Experience Canada (IEC)
Youth mobility program offering open and employer-specific permits to eligible participants from partner countries.

Post-Graduation Work Permit (PGWP)
Open work permits allowing graduates of eligible Canadian institutions to gain Canadian work experience.

Significant Benefit to Canada
For workers whose employment offers substantial economic, social, or cultural benefits, such as self-employed entrepreneurs.

Reciprocal Employment
Employment based on reciprocal agreements providing Canadians similar opportunities abroad, including academic and performing arts exchanges.

Francophone Mobility
Skilled francophone workers recruited outside Quebec under federal-provincial agreements to support linguistic diversity.

Spouses of Workers and Students
Permits allowing spouses or common-law partners of foreign workers or students to work in Canada under specified conditions.

Prospective Permanent Residents
Bridging Open Work Permit (BOWP) for Express Entry or PNP applicants awaiting permanent residency approval.
